Bootstrap versus Foundation: Comparison

Aug 7, 2023
Blog

Introduction

In the world of front-end development, choosing the right framework can greatly impact your project's success. Among the most popular options are Bootstrap and Foundation, both known for their extensive feature sets, responsive capabilities, and user-friendly components. In this article, we will delve into a comprehensive comparison of these frameworks to help you make an informed decision based on your specific needs and preferences.

Understanding Bootstrap

Bootstrap, developed by Twitter, has become one of the most widely used front-end frameworks due to its robust functionality and ease of use. With Bootstrap, developers have a powerful toolkit at their disposal, enabling them to create responsive, mobile-first websites efficiently.

Key Features of Bootstrap

  • Grid System: Bootstrap's grid system provides a solid foundation for creating responsive layouts across different devices and screen sizes. Its flexible grid allows for seamless adaptation to various resolutions.
  • Pre-designed Components: Bootstrap offers a wide range of pre-designed components and UI elements, such as navigation bars, buttons, forms, and more. These out-of-the-box components save developers time and effort in designing and coding from scratch.
  • Customization: Bootstrap's extensive list of customizable variables and classes allows developers to personalize the framework to match their project requirements. It provides flexibility while maintaining consistency.
  • Browser Compatibility: Bootstrap ensures excellent browser compatibility, making it easier to develop websites that work seamlessly across different browsers and versions.

The Advantages of Foundation

Foundation, developed by ZURB, is another popular front-end framework that boasts a strong following in the web development community. It offers a powerful set of tools and features, equipping developers with the capabilities to build stunning websites efficiently.

Notable Features of Foundation

  • Responsive Design: Foundation places a strong emphasis on responsive design, enabling developers to create websites that adapt flawlessly to different screen sizes and devices. This focus on mobile-first development ensures a positive user experience across platforms.
  • Modularity: Foundation provides a modular approach to web development, allowing developers to pick and choose the components they need. This flexibility ensures efficient project management and avoids the inclusion of unnecessary code, resulting in faster page load times.
  • Accessibility: Foundation prioritizes accessibility by adhering to web standards and best practices. It promotes semantic HTML, making it easier for search engines to crawl and index content.
  • Expandability: Foundation's ecosystem includes a vast array of plugins and extensions, extending its functionality and enabling developers to add advanced features to their projects with ease.

Choosing the Right Framework for Your Business

When selecting between Bootstrap and Foundation, it is crucial to consider your specific project requirements, team skillsets, and long-term goals. Both frameworks offer immense value and can cater to a wide range of needs. Here are some key factors to help you make an informed decision:

Factors to Consider:

1. Learning Curve

Bootstrap: Bootstrap's extensive documentation and vast community support make it relatively easy for developers to get up to speed quickly. Its widespread adoption means that finding resources, tutorials, and community-driven solutions is relatively effortless.

Foundation: Foundation also provides comprehensive documentation, but it may have a steeper learning curve for beginners. However, its modular approach allows developers to learn and implement only the components they need, streamlining the learning process over time.

2. Design Customization

Bootstrap: Bootstrap's extensive range of themes, templates, and customization options make it an excellent choice for developers seeking rapid prototyping or projects where design consistency is critical. Its consistency, however, can limit the uniqueness of the final product if customization is not prioritized.

Foundation: Foundation provides a flexible styling structure that allows more freedom for customization. Its modular approach ensures that developers can easily tailor the design to meet specific project requirements and create unique visual experiences.

3. Project Scope and Requirements

Bootstrap: If you require more pre-designed components and an extensive feature set out-of-the-box, Bootstrap may be the better choice. It offers a comprehensive selection of robust components that ensure faster development and consistent results.

Foundation: For projects that prioritize performance and efficiency, Foundation's emphasis on modularity and lightweight code offers distinct advantages. It allows developers to include only the necessary components, resulting in faster load times and improved website performance.

4. Community and Support

Bootstrap: Bootstrap's popularity has resulted in a massive community of developers who continuously contribute new ideas, extensions, and resources. This vibrant community ensures that developers have access to a wealth of support, forums, and plugins.

Foundation: While Foundation may have a slightly smaller community compared to Bootstrap, it still boasts dedicated followers and offers extensive support documentation. Its supportive community ensures timely assistance and enriches the overall experience of using the framework.

Conclusion

Both Bootstrap and Foundation offer powerful solutions for front-end development, catering to various project requirements and developer preferences. Bootstrap's ease of use and comprehensive feature set make it a reliable choice for rapid development and design consistency. On the other hand, Foundation's focus on modularity and lightweight code ensures performance optimization and a more customizable approach.

Ultimately, the decision between Bootstrap and Foundation depends on your specific needs, team expertise, and project goals. Familiarizing yourself with the features, strengths, and weaknesses of these frameworks will empower you to make an informed choice that results in a robust and successful online presence for your business.

Lindsey O'Halloran
I've been using Bootstrap for its pre-built components, but after reading this article, I'm considering exploring Foundation's approach to more modular components.
Nov 17, 2023
Allen Friedman
The UI components in Bootstrap are convenient and easy to use. They've been a time-saver in my projects.
Nov 14, 2023
Leo Dasso
The comparison of the documentation and support for Bootstrap and Foundation was insightful. It can make a big difference in the development process.
Nov 13, 2023
Shann Maddox
I appreciate the clarity in the article's breakdown of the integration with JavaScript frameworks, shedding light on how Bootstrap and Foundation interact with other technologies.
Nov 11, 2023
Sharon Brudnicki
Foundation's approach to typography and the use of native font stacks appeal to me as a designer. It can greatly enhance the visual appeal of a website.
Nov 10, 2023
Arno Schleussner
I've been contemplating the impact on SEO in my framework choice, and the article's comparison of SEO-friendly features in Bootstrap and Foundation was a crucial factor in my decision-making process.
Nov 10, 2023
Alina Tse
The comparison of the available extensions and third-party plugins for Bootstrap and Foundation was an insightful look at their extensibility and the wider ecosystem built around them.
Nov 7, 2023
Felipe Araujo
The comparison of the utility classes and helper functions in Bootstrap and Foundation was an insightful look at the frameworks' approach to aiding developers in their workflow.
Nov 6, 2023
Jeffrey Nitterhouse
I would love to see a more in-depth analysis of the support and community around these frameworks. It's an important aspect for long-term maintenance of projects.
Nov 3, 2023
Claire Repelliu
As a beginner in web development, the insights in this article have helped me understand the key differences between Bootstrap and Foundation. It's valuable knowledge.
Nov 3, 2023
Liz Murphy
As a designer, I found the article's breakdown of typography and font options in Bootstrap and Foundation to be informative in understanding their visual design capabilities.
Oct 31, 2023
Cody Moren
The section on accessibility and inclusive design considerations in the comparison of Bootstrap and Foundation was a reminder of the importance of creating a web for all.
Oct 31, 2023
Joe Batson
I appreciate the structure and organization of Foundation, which makes it more intuitive to navigate through and customize according to project requirements.
Oct 29, 2023
Maeve Fitzgerald
As a frontend developer, I've found the article's breakdown of the grid systems in Bootstrap and Foundation to be illuminating in understanding their respective approaches to layout.
Oct 27, 2023
Danny Ramroop
I found the section on mobile-first approach to be really informative. It's definitely a crucial factor to consider when choosing a front-end framework.
Oct 26, 2023
Tony Shah
The article's thorough comparison of design principles and philosophies behind Bootstrap and Foundation provided valuable insights into their approach to creating user interfaces.
Oct 24, 2023
Bill Diesch
I'm curious to explore the impact of using Bootstrap or Foundation on SEO. It's an area that might influence the choice for some projects.
Oct 22, 2023
Bask Iyer
Can we have a follow-up article on the integration of Bootstrap and Foundation with different javascript frameworks? It would be great to see examples and best practices.
Oct 22, 2023
Stephen Santulli
I found the article's breakdown of the grid classes and structure in Bootstrap and Foundation to be particularly enlightening for a novice developer like myself.
Oct 21, 2023
Donna Mete
I've been using both Bootstrap and Foundation, and I found that the customization options in Bootstrap are more extensive and easier to implement.
Oct 18, 2023
Greg Jarrow
The article's focus on the overall community and support around Bootstrap and Foundation highlighted the importance of a thriving ecosystem for a framework's long-term success.
Oct 16, 2023
Lisa Pilar
The flexibility of Foundation's grid system appeals to me as a developer. It seems like it would suit my projects better.
Oct 14, 2023
Joe Hartman
The article's detailed comparison of the documentation and examples available for Bootstrap and Foundation was a comprehensive overview of their support and learning resources.
Oct 13, 2023
William Gilbert
The article's insight into the development philosophies behind Bootstrap and Foundation gave me a deeper appreciation for the considerations put into these frameworks.
Oct 13, 2023
Genny Salvatore
The insights into browser support in the comparison of Bootstrap and Foundation were a crucial element for my decision-making in choosing a framework for a project.
Oct 13, 2023
David Manugian
The insights into customization and theming options in Bootstrap and Foundation have provided valuable perspective for creating unique and personalized user interfaces.
Oct 13, 2023
Herb Borden
I appreciate the thorough comparison of Bootstrap and Foundation in this article. It's really helpful for someone who's trying to decide which framework to use.
Oct 12, 2023
Tom Lee
The article touched on crucial aspects like usability testing in the comparison of Bootstrap and Foundation. It's a testament to the thoroughness of the analysis.
Oct 12, 2023
Ayinde Abiola
I've had experience using both Bootstrap and Foundation, and I found that Bootstrap's grid system is more intuitive for my projects.
Oct 10, 2023
Catherine Connor
The comparison of the available utility classes and helper functions in Bootstrap and Foundation was an insightful look at their respective approaches to aiding developers in their workflow.
Oct 7, 2023
Kim Sonner
The article's breakdown of the user experience considerations and ergonomic design philosophies in Bootstrap and Foundation gave me a deeper understanding of their approach to usability.
Oct 7, 2023
Gordon Wandler
I've relied on the extensive utility classes in Bootstrap for quick prototyping. They've been a game-changer in speeding up the development process.
Oct 7, 2023
Mohamed Aslam
The article's comparison of the JavaScript components and plugins available for Bootstrap and Foundation was a comprehensive overview of their functionality.
Oct 6, 2023
Gary Laurent
As a developer, I found the article's breakdown of browser compatibility and support for Bootstrap and Foundation to be valuable insight into creating universally accessible user interfaces.
Oct 5, 2023
Mark Duce
The article's emphasis on performance optimization in the comparison of Bootstrap and Foundation highlighted the importance of speed and efficiency in web development.
Oct 4, 2023
Joanna Ewing
I've been contending between Bootstrap and Foundation, and the insights on development and support resources have helped me see the broader ecosystem around these frameworks.
Oct 4, 2023
Michael Mihalevich
I appreciate the comprehensive comparison of the available themes and styles for Bootstrap and Foundation, providing a closer look at their default design options.
Oct 3, 2023
Meredith Brown
I appreciate the thorough comparison of performance and optimization features in Bootstrap and Foundation, highlighting the importance of creating efficient and fast user interfaces.
Sep 30, 2023
Mark Derosa
I appreciate the balanced comparison in the article, highlighting the strengths and weaknesses of both Bootstrap and Foundation.
Sep 29, 2023
David Geronimo
I've been pondering over whether to use Bootstrap or Foundation for my next project, and this article has provided a well-rounded comparison to aid in that decision.
Sep 28, 2023
Alex McRae
The article's comparison of the grid breakpoints and media queries in Bootstrap and Foundation was an eye-opener in understanding their responsive capabilities.
Sep 24, 2023
Robert Clinite
I like how the article addressed the accessibility aspect of both Bootstrap and Foundation. It's an important consideration for inclusive web design.
Sep 23, 2023
Ann Gonzalez
The comparison of the grid systems and layouts in Bootstrap and Foundation was an enlightening overview of their approaches to creating flexible and responsive designs.
Sep 22, 2023
Melody Vice
I'm looking forward to testing the performance differences between Bootstrap and Foundation for my upcoming project. It's a crucial factor in providing a seamless user experience.
Sep 13, 2023
John Larson
The support for RTL (Right-to-Left) languages is a big factor for the international projects I work on. It's an area where these frameworks differ.
Sep 12, 2023
Tracie Coffman
As a designer, I've always preferred the customization options available in Foundation. It gives me more creative control over the design.
Sep 12, 2023
Olivia Holden
The comparison of the available extensions and plugins for Bootstrap and Foundation provided valuable insights into their extensibility.
Sep 11, 2023
Steve Armond
I'm more interested in the user experience comparison between Bootstrap and Foundation. It's an aspect that can sway the decision for many projects.
Sep 10, 2023
Brian Smestad
The article has given me a lot to think about in terms of choosing the right framework for my upcoming projects. It's a decision that can have a major impact.
Sep 9, 2023
Brooke Divins
I've been using Foundation for a while, and the consistency in its framework updates and new features has kept me satisfied with the choice.
Sep 9, 2023
Amalie Frauenknecht
The article's insight into the overall design philosophy and aesthetic approach of Bootstrap and Foundation provided valuable perspective for decision-making in projects.
Sep 8, 2023
Jim Seals
The article's emphasis on accessibility and inclusivity in the comparison of Bootstrap and Foundation highlighted the importance of creating designs that are truly for everyone.
Sep 5, 2023
Heidi Kuss
I'm impressed with the detailed breakdown of the grid systems in Bootstrap and Foundation. It's a crucial aspect for responsive design.
Sep 4, 2023
Blake Williams
The insights into the performance optimization and speed considerations in Bootstrap and Foundation have been crucial in my decision-making for a new project.
Sep 4, 2023
Sigmund Salamonsen
The article's focus on the support and resources available for Bootstrap and Foundation illustrated the importance of community and documentation in the development process.
Aug 31, 2023
Jamie Wing
I've been using Bootstrap for most of my projects, but after reading this article, I'm considering giving Foundation a try for its more modular approach.
Aug 28, 2023
Wendy Sosa
Foundation's approach to SASS and mixins is one of the reasons I lean towards using it in my projects. It provides a cleaner and more organized structure for styles.
Aug 27, 2023
Jordan Richards
I've found that Bootstrap's extensive community and resources available online have been a huge help in troubleshooting and learning new techniques.
Aug 26, 2023
Joseph Sweeney
I've always appreciated Bootstrap's comprehensive documentation, which has been a lifesaver in navigating through its features and components.
Aug 24, 2023
Matt Mercier
The article's comparison of the default styles and themes for Bootstrap and Foundation was enlightening. It's something I tend to overlook when choosing a framework.
Aug 20, 2023
Santiago Vega
The performance comparison between Bootstrap and Foundation was an eye-opener. It's essential to consider the impact on website speed.
Aug 20, 2023
Keisha Lewis
As a frontend developer, the comparison of the overall mobile responsiveness and touch-swipe support for Bootstrap and Foundation was crucial information for me.
Aug 18, 2023
Brandon Mount
The comparison of the grid breakpoint and media query systems in Bootstrap and Foundation was an insightful overview of their approach to creating responsive designs.
Aug 17, 2023
Katie Harbron
The insights on accessibility and inclusive design considerations for both Bootstrap and Foundation were an eye-opener for me. It's an area that's often overlooked.
Aug 15, 2023
Brennen Matthews
The article's overview of the available JavaScript components and plugins for Bootstrap and Foundation provided a valuable understanding of their extensibility and functional capabilities.
Aug 13, 2023
Chen-Lun Chang
The article's insights into the customization options and extensibility features in Bootstrap and Foundation provided valuable perspective for selecting the right framework.
Aug 13, 2023
Gregory Johnston
I appreciate the focus on browser compatibility in the comparison. It's crucial for ensuring a seamless experience across different devices and browsers.
Aug 13, 2023
Kirk Weir
I appreciate the detailed comparison of the grid systems and layouts in Bootstrap and Foundation, offering valuable insight into their respective approaches to building responsive designs.
Aug 9, 2023
Tom Calvert
I've been considering the impact on SEO in my framework choice, and this article's comparison of SEO-friendly features in Bootstrap and Foundation was helpful in making a decision.
Aug 9, 2023